FURTHER READING
Bergeron, David M. “Alchemy and Timon of Athens.” CLA Journal XIII, No. 4 (June 1970): 364-73.
Applies the philosophical tenets of alchemy allegorically to interpret the play.
Bizley, W. H. “Language and Currency in Timon of Athens.” Theoria XLIV (May 1975): 21-42.
Examines the language Shakespeare employs to discuss cultural beliefs about money.
Cohen, Derek.“The Politics of Wealth: Timon of Athens.” Neophilologus LXXVII, No. 1, (January 1993): 149-60.
Explores the multifaced role of wealth and poverty in Timon of Athens, arguing that not only is it at the center of the drama but that Shakespeare proposes revolutionary ideas.
